What Makes DIFC Unique for Business Setup?

DIFC Features

Strategic Location

Positioned at the heart of Dubai, DIFC offers unmatched connectivity to markets in Europe, Asia, and Africa.

Common Law Framework

DIFC operates under English common law, providing clarity, transparency, and global legal standards.

Business Ownership

Enjoy 100% foreign ownership and full repatriation of profits.

Tax-Free Advantages

Benefit from 0% corporate and income taxes on qualifying income.

Global Recognition

Home to over 5500 businesses, including top financial institutions and multinational corporations.

Why Choose DIFC for Company Formation?

DIFC is designed to attract:

Financial Institutions

Banks, insurance companies, and asset managers

Professional Services

Consultancy, accounting, and legal services

Technology and innovation-driven companies
Foundations and holding companies

For wealth management and asset protection

With a robust regulatory framework under the Dubai Financial Services Authority (DFSA),

DIFC ensures that businesses operate in a secure and transparent environment.

Steps to Set Up Your Business in DIFC

1

Initial Consultation

Connect with Flyingcolour® Business Consultant to identify the right business activity and structure.

2

Application Submission

Prepare and submit all required documents to the DIFC Authority.

3

DFSA Approval

For regulated businesses, obtain necessary approvals from DFSA.

4

Company Registration

Register your entity with the DIFC Registrar of Companies (ROC).

5

Office Leasing

Secure premium office space within the DIFC zone.

6

Licensing

Receive your business license to commence operations.

Frequently Asked Questions

DIFC company formation refers to setting up a business within the Dubai International Financial Centre (DIFC), a leading financial free zone in the UAE. It operates under an independent legal and regulatory framework based on common law, making it attractive for global businesses and financial institutions.

Yes, DIFC companies allow 100% foreign ownership with no requirement for a local sponsor, making it an ideal choice for international investors and multinational corporations.

The setup timeline can vary depending on the business activity and regulatory approvals, but many DIFC company formations can be completed within a few weeks if all documentation is in order.
